    Crackers Covermore in Australia will cover you. I have just purchased a policy for lady Cow and princess Cow who will be arriving here shortly from Thailand. It was cheaper than a friend who sells insurance in Thailand could do with much better benefits. The catch is they only have one policy not a variety but it has unlimited medical and at least you have Australian rules of disclosure. I use covermore when I go to Thailand and found them good when I have had a claim.
